mirror of
https://github.com/fusionpbx/fusionpbx.git
synced 2026-01-06 11:43:50 +00:00
Clean up pdo.php.
This commit is contained in:
@@ -249,17 +249,13 @@ if ($db_type == "pgsql") {
|
|||||||
unset($result, $prep_statement);
|
unset($result, $prep_statement);
|
||||||
natsort($domain_names);
|
natsort($domain_names);
|
||||||
//get the domains in the natural sort order
|
//get the domains in the natural sort order
|
||||||
$sql = "select * from v_domains ";
|
|
||||||
//$sql .= "order by field(domain_name, '".implode("','", $domain_names)."') ";
|
|
||||||
//$sql .= "order by domain_name asc ";
|
|
||||||
$sql .= "order by case ";
|
|
||||||
$n = 1;
|
$n = 1;
|
||||||
|
$sql = "select * from v_domains order by case ";
|
||||||
foreach ($domain_names as $dn) {
|
foreach ($domain_names as $dn) {
|
||||||
$sql .= "when domain_name = '".$dn."' then ".$n." ";
|
$sql .= "when domain_name = '".$dn."' then ".$n." ";
|
||||||
$n++;
|
$n++;
|
||||||
}
|
}
|
||||||
$sql .= "else ".$n." end ";
|
$sql .= "else ".$n." end ";
|
||||||
//echo $sql; exit;
|
|
||||||
$prep_statement = $db->prepare($sql);
|
$prep_statement = $db->prepare($sql);
|
||||||
$prep_statement->execute();
|
$prep_statement->execute();
|
||||||
$result = $prep_statement->fetchAll(PDO::FETCH_NAMED);
|
$result = $prep_statement->fetchAll(PDO::FETCH_NAMED);
|
||||||
|
|||||||
Reference in New Issue
Block a user